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Accessibility at Hertford East

Hertford East train station offers a range of facilities to ensure a smooth journey, starting with ticketing options that are easy and accessible. The ticket office is open during the weekdays from 07:15 to 18:00, while on Saturdays it's open from 07:40 to 14:30. While there isn't a service on Sundays, you can still buy tickets through the available ticket machines or by collecting pre-booked tickets from the accessible machines, complete with induction loops for those with hearing impairments.

Accessibility at Hertford East is a top-notch priority. The station is rated as a category A station, meaning it provides step-free access throughout. This includes easy ramp access to trains along with accessible toilets. Although there are no waiting rooms, seating options are available on the station concourse; refreshments can also be found via a vending machine and a nearby coffee shop, with a Tesco located just across the road for last-minute purchases.

The car park, managed by National Car Parks Ltd, is open all week with 17 parking spaces including one accessible space. Charges apply, including a daily rate of £6.30 and a variety of season ticket options for frequent travelers.

Onward Travel Options

Hertford East doesn’t leave you stranded when it comes to onward travel. There's a taxi kiosk in the booking hall for quick rides, and the station participates in the PlusBus scheme—a convenient option for integrating train and bus travel with one ticket. In case of service disruptions, replacement buses stop right across the station entrance, ensuring you're never left stranded.

Station Facilities and Amenities

London Road (Guildford) station is well-equipped for your travel needs. The ticket office is open from 06:30 to 13:00 on weekdays and 09:00 to 14:00 on Saturdays. While there's no ticket office service on Sundays, ticket machines are available for you to buy and collect tickets at any time. Additionally, these machines are accessible for individuals with disabilities, and induction loops are available for those with hearing impairments.

The station features heated waiting rooms on both platforms and CCTV for your safety. However, it's worth noting that facilities such as shops, ATM machines, and refreshment outlets are not available on-site, so it's a good idea to plan ahead if you require these services.

Accessibility

This station prioritizes accessibility with some step-free access available. While platform 2, which services trains towards Guildford, offers level access, platform 1 does not have step-free access. Assistance for boarding or alighting from trains is handled by the train's guard, and while dedicated staff help isn't available, customer help points are on site to assist passengers.

Accessible parking is available with two designated spaces, though you might want to confirm details ahead as equipment for accessible parking is not provided.

Onward Travel Options

Connectivity from London Road (Guildford) is smooth and efficient. Rail replacement services operate from the Guildford side station forecourt, ensuring your journey continues seamlessly even during disruptions. While the station doesn't facilitate taxi or car hire services directly, alternate transport options are available nearby.
